Les Pimprenelles Villa - Carcassonne
43.2038, 2.36269Situated merely 11 minutes on foot from Murs de Carcassonne, Les Pimprenelles Villa invites guests to relax at a terrace.
Location
You'll be merely 600 metres from La Cite Medievale and only 1.8 km from Place Carnot. The villa is 10 minutes' drive from Australian Park.
Salvaza airport is situated 10 km away, while Cite Medievale bus station is at a moderate distance from the villa.
Rooms
Guests can make use of a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, as well as air conditioning. Featuring a walk-in shower, a separate toilet, and a bath, the bathroom also comes with hair dryers and bath sheets.
Eat & Drink
There is a fully equipped kitchen including a microwave oven, an electric kettle, and a refrigerator. Le Parc Franck Putelat, serving a wide range of meals, is a mere 250 metres away.
